Output 915002409355ef1f2774183d57101c83bfcea73a7fc00f4b9314c6f59fceb18d:0

value
7556521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5b8f4384b93a2d8ec3e40c3a3210b9ddfce5d17 OP_EQUAL
address
3MB5REPoF6BJSG4Am48wKcQ9pHfu96K9kD
transaction
915002409355ef1f2774183d57101c83bfcea73a7fc00f4b9314c6f59fceb18d
confirmations
391084
spent
true